Hi, I can't find that specific error code in the documentation on that model of machine, however, in general in Xerox machines U8-3 means that your exposure lamp is blown or has a problem
J1 code on the XD100 series means that your toner cartridge is empty. You will need to order in a new one or have your existing cartridge refilled. Refills run about $60.00 and new ones are in the $100 to $125 range.

J1 means your machine has detected an empty toner cartridge. You may be able to shake it and get some more copies out of it. but on that machine J1 is pretty accurate.

J1 is detecting either a low or out of toner condition.
Maybe just need to have the cartridge shook, replaced or it could lastly need the toner sensor replaced.
